首頁 >後端開發 >php教程 >如何使用 PHP 輕鬆將文件附加到電子郵件?

如何使用 PHP 輕鬆將文件附加到電子郵件?

Patricia Arquette
Patricia Arquette原創
2024-12-23 02:49:09365瀏覽

How Can I Easily Attach Files to Emails Using PHP?

使用PHP 的Mail() 函數將文件附加到電子郵件

使用PHP 的郵件() 函數發送電子郵件附件可能是一項艱鉅的任務。雖然這是可能的,但該過程涉及複雜的步驟和潛在的陷阱。

一種替代方法是使用 PHPMailer 腳本,它可以顯著簡化該過程。要開始使用 PHPMailer:

  1. 下載 PHPMailer: 從 GitHub 的官方儲存庫檢索腳本。
  2. 提取並包含:提取 PHPMailer 檔案並將其主腳本檔案 (class.phpmailer.php) 包含在您的專案中。
  3. 實例化和配置:建立一個新的 PHPMailer 實例,設定其寄件者訊息,並使用主題和正文撰寫電子郵件。

關鍵步驟在於附加文件。使用 PHPMailer,就像這樣簡單:

$file_to_attach = 'PATH_OF_YOUR_FILE_HERE';
$email->AddAttachment($file_to_attach, 'NameOfFile.pdf');

這一行毫不費力地附加您想要的檔案及其指定的檔案名稱。發送電子郵件同樣簡單:

$email->Send();

透過採用 PHPMailer,您可以繞過 mail() 函數的複雜性,確保在 PHP 中發送帶有附件的電子郵件的無憂體驗。

以上是如何使用 PHP 輕鬆將文件附加到電子郵件?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n